Vancouver, Washington, lies along the Columbia River, on the Washington-Oregon border. It has been named as one of the best places to live in America, by Money magazine. The city is known for its arts and cultural scene, architecture, and annual events. Residents have included former U.S. President Ulysses S. Grant.
Two school districts serve Vancouver - Vancouver Public Schools and the Evergreen School District. Skyview High School, rated Silver by U.S. News & World Report, is also ranked #37 in the state. Columbia River High and Hela High School have Bronze ratings. In these schools, your academic performance bears a lot of weight for later on. Vancouver is home to Clark College. Although this is a two-year institution, comprehensive degree options are available through partnerships with Washington State University, Portland State University, and others. Washington State also has a campus in the city, and offers over 40 fields of study. Educational attractions in Vancouver include the Fort Vancouver National Historic Site. There's a visitors' center at the 19th-century trading outpost, plus a full-scale replica of the original fort that is open to the public. You can view baking, blacksmithing, carpentry, and kitchen facilities. Another attraction, the Clark County Historical Museum has a Native American craft exhibit and other rotating exhibits focused on local history and culture. Several educational projects are run in partnership with local schools, including an investigation of historical artifacts excavated when the Vancouver Convention Center and Hilton Hotel were built.
Other places to visit in the area are Heritage Art Gallery and the Main Street district, where you can find antiques, food, yogurt, and more. The Downtown Vancouver Art District includes the Kiggins Theatre, built in 1936. Concerts, themed events, and a chamber music series are performed by the Vancouver Symphony Orchestra throughout the year. In addition, you'll find athletic facilities in the city's parks. The Vancouver Mall is another popular destination, and it has over 140 shops plus major anchor stores. You can also enjoy golf at the nearby Royal Oaks Country Club.
